We got this from Neil Laughlin. Neil and Robin had their 1964 Daytona 289 four speed at the PSMCDR, with Robin as the driver and Neil as the crew. This was the first time Robin has raced in the Pure Stock Drags. She did a fantastic job and won her Shootout, that got her an invitation to the bracket race. This race you run eliminations on your qualifying time and each pair is a handicapped start. All the racers invited are shootout winners.

We just got home and wanted to give a quick update on the bracket race.
20 cars were entered.* Robin beat a 73 Firebird Formula 455 in the first round when he red lighted. *10 cars remaining.* She beat a 6.6l TA in 2nd round.. *5 cars left.* She beat a 70 GTO Judge in the 3rd round.* He went under his qualifying time and lost. *3 cars remaining.* Robin got a by run on the 4th round for her 0.163 reaction time on the previous run. *2 cars remaining (finals).* She lost to a Plymouth Duster in the finals.* They both ran under their qualifying times but he was closer to his than Robin was.* She lost because she was too fast!* He did get to the finish line before her by 0.1053 sec.* Very close. *
So she was the only Stude in the bracket race and made it to the final round.* She was bummed she didn't win the big trophy but the last race was so close and she ran her best ET for the weekend.* Too bad it was that round.
